Que puis-je pour vous ?
Du back au front, du projet monolitique au produit cloud ready, je peux intervenir sur tout le spectre de votre application. Selon l'ampleur du projet je peux soit rejoindre une équipe soit travailler en pleinne autonomie. Parlons ensemble de vos besoins !
De l'infrastructure déclarative, robuste et reproductible, à l'integration d'une chaîne d'outils sur tout le cycle de développement, l'ingénieurie logiciel coordonne aujourd'hui les meilleurs applications. Discutons ensemble de vos besoin !
Pour vous, toute une chaîne d'outils
FullStack
& DevOps
Savoir-faire inclus
Software Craftmanship
( ou l'« Artisanat du logiciel » )
Choisissez parmi les meilleures stratégies actuelles, quelles cléfs donner à votre produit ! Grâce à ma pratique tous les champs d'action ci-dessous sont accessibles :
Test driven developement
La stratégie de non-régression peut faire partie intégrante de votre processus de développement grâce à la généralisation des tests. Avec le Test driven développement la précédence des tests offre un haut niveau de confiance dans la qualité de vos livrables.
Intégration continue
Coopération rime avec intégration : homogénéiser le code, automatiser les tests et alerter des problèmes de manière continue c'est se prémunir d'une érosion logiciel inévitable.
Containerisation
En développement, test ou production, la contenairisation a de nombreux avantages. Elle peut être utilisée sur tout ou partie d'un projet, en transition ou à la conception. Elle est l'outil modulaire par excellence.
Twelve-Factor App
Dans l'univers du cloud et du distribué, l'architecture de nos applications à été repensée : des Microservices aux Function as a Service en passant par le Design for failure les 12 factors font la base de ces nouveaux logiciels.
Blue/Green deploiement
"Publiez tôt, publiez souvent" et sans interruptions grâce aux déploiements transparents du Blue/Green deploy; Une première étape vers un déploiement continu.
Monitoring
Le bond fait par les solutions de monitoring va de paire avec l'accélération du Time to Market. La collecte centralisée des logs et metrics est un outil de communication puissant entre Dev et Ops afin d'aligner leurs enjeux.
Infrastructure As Code
Quand les atouts du logiciel s'offrent aux infrastructures; Reproductibilité, automatisation et coopération se mettent en marche au service de la fiabilité.
Responsive Web Design
Avec la disposition Flexbox la gestion du design responsive est aujourd'hui pleinement qualitative. Il est aussi facile de gérer 5 breakpoints ou plus, pour s'afficher sur tous les appareils. Le compileur Babel permet de plus une compatibilité maximale avec toutes les configurations client.
Tarifs des préstations
Mes trois domaines de compétences
Développement logiciel
- Développeur full-stack
- Développeur back-end
- Lead Web Développeur
Mise en place d'infrastructures
- Chaine d'outils DevOps
- Infrastructure as Code
- Conteneurisation
- Ingénieurie Cloud
Gestion de projet
- Product Owner
- Chef de projet
- DevOps Evangelist
Choisisez l'agilité !
- Grâce à mon expérience transversales et grâce à mes capacités d'écoute et d'interaction, je saurais m’intégrer à vos équipes projets avec habilité. En tant que freelance, j’ai aussi la souplesse et l'autonomie pour prendre à ma charge certaines montées en compétence dans vos domaines favoris.
Confiez moi vos missions 100% télétravail
Thomas Castellengo
@ Mesnil-Saint-Père - 100% télétravail
Disponible pour des missions dev-Fullstack, dev-Backend, DevOps et IaC.
Ingénieur logiciel - Sénior
✓ Diplomé «Master Of Science» (niveau I, Bac +5).